Marine Training May Take More Mental Than Physical Stamina

The U.S. armed force has an ongoing need for service participants that can serve in elite and specialized military units, such as the Marine Corps. Nonetheless, the failure rate for these forces is high as a result of the really extensive training.

A brand-new research study recommends that when it involves surviving Marine Corps training, psychological aspects may matter more than physical performance end results.

To help identify predictors of success or failure in elite basic training, Leslie Saxon, MD, executive supervisor of the University of Southern California (USC) Center for Body Computing, and also Center for Body Computing scientists kept an eye on the physical as well as mental activity of 3 consecutive courses of Marines and also sailors enrolled in a 25-day specialized training program.

An overall of 121 trainees took part in the research study, however only somewhat over half (64) successfully finished the course.

In general, the researchers located no web link between ending up the course and efficiency on physical training criteria, such as hikes or water training. Physical pens such as heart rate or sleep condition likewise did not play a role.

Instead, the most significant determinant was mental. Trainees that recognized themselves as extroverted and also having a favorable affect– the capacity to grow a happy, positive perspective– were most likely to complete the training course.

” These searchings for are novel due to the fact that they recognize attributes not commonly associated with armed forces performance, revealing that psychological variables mattered greater than physical performance results,” claims Saxon, that is also a cardiologist with Keck Medicine of USC as well as a professor of medication (medical scholar) at the Keck School of Medicine of USC.

Furthermore, the scientists were able to determine emotional stressors that activated dropping out of the training course. Students normally stop before a stressful marine training workout or after reporting a boost in emotional or physical discomfort and a decrease in self-confidence. This led scientists to be able to predict that would drop out of the program one to two days beforehand.

While Saxon has actually been studying human efficiency in elite athletes for 15 years, this was her very first research study including the armed force. She partnered with the USC Institute for Creative Technologies, which has actually established army research study programs, to run the study with a training firm in Camp Pendleton, Calif. that trains Marines in aquatic reconnaissance. Commonly, just around half of the participants end up the training.

Prior to the students took the course, the researchers had actually gathered standard individuality analyses, evaluating character kind, emotional handling, expectation on life and also mindfulness. Scientist following provided subjects with an iPhone as well as Apple Watch, as well as a specially designed mobile application to accumulate constant daily actions of students’ mental condition, physical pain, heart price, task, sleep, hydration as well as nourishment throughout training.

The mobile application likewise prompted trainees to answer daily studies on psychological and also physical pain, wellness and self-confidence in program completion as well as instructor support.

” This research, the very first to collect continual data from individuals throughout a training, suggests that there might be treatments the armed force can require to lower the number of dropouts,” claims Saxon.

” This data can be helpful in making future training programs for Marines and also various other army units to increase the variety of elite service members, as well as provide understandings on just how to aid professional athletes as well as other high entertainers deal with difficulties.”

Saxon is already evaluating whether various mental interventions or coaching might encourage a lot more trainees to remain in the program.
